Adjusting to this new experience

The beginning of your Invisalign treatment is an exciting time. Let’s walk through what the first few days and weeks might feel like, as your teeth begin shifting into their ideal positions:

Getting comfortable with your aligners

When you first start wearing your Invisalign aligners, you might notice some tightness or pressure — this is normal and indicates that your aligners are working. Unlike braces, there are no wires or brackets to adjust to, but you may feel a slight discomfort as your teeth begin to move. This sensation usually subsides after the first few days.

Aligners and your bite

As your teeth move, you may feel a slight shift in your bite. This is part of the realignment process, and it’s a positive sign that your treatment is progressing. With Invisalign, these changes are typically more subtle compared to braces, but you’ll notice them as your smile transforms.

Tips for a smooth start with Invisalign

Managing initial discomfort

Over-the-counter pain relief can be useful if you experience any discomfort during the first few days. Wearing your aligners as prescribed — typically 20-22 hours a day — will help your teeth adjust more quickly.

Staying on track

Switching to a new set of aligners typically happens every one to two weeks. We’ll provide you with a clear schedule to follow, ensuring your treatment stays on track.

Maintaining oral hygiene

One of the perks of Invisalign is that you can remove the aligners to eat and brush your teeth. Just make sure to clean your aligners and teeth thoroughly after meals to keep your smile healthy throughout treatment.

Hydration is key

Drinking plenty of water while wearing your aligners is essential. Staying hydrated helps prevent dry mouth and keeps your aligners fresh. Remember, remove your aligners before consuming anything other than water to avoid staining.

Your Questions Answered

Will my aligners cause discomfort?

Some pressure is normal, but it generally fades within a few days of starting a new set of aligners.

Can I eat anything I want?

With Invisalign, you can eat whatever you like, but you’ll need to remove your aligners first. Just remember to brush before putting them back in!

How do I keep my aligners clean?

We recommend brushing your aligners with a soft toothbrush and rinsing them with lukewarm water. Avoid hot water, as it can warp the plastic.

How long will my treatment take?

Treatment time varies based on your unique needs, but we’ll provide a personalized plan during your consultation to give you a clear idea of your timeline.
